Replacement: brake pads – VW SHARAN (7N1, 7N2). Tip from AUTODOC experts:
Perform the replacement of brake pads in complete set for each axis. This provides effective braking.
The replacement procedure is identical for all brake pads on the same axle.
Please note: all work on the car – VW SHARAN (7N1, 7N2) – should be done with the engine switched off.
Carry out replacement in the following order:
Step 1
Connect the scan and service tool.
Step 2
Put the parking brake system into service mode.
Step 3
Open the hood.
Step 4
Clean the brake fluid reservoir cap. Use a brake cleaner.
AUTODOC recommends:
Replacement: brake pads – VW SHARAN (7N1, 7N2). After applying the spray, wait a few minutes.
Step 5
Unscrew the engine solenoid valve bracket. Use Torx T27. Use a ratchet wrench.
Step 6
Unscrew the brake fluid reservoir cap.
Step 7
Secure the wheels with chocks.
Step 8
Loosen the wheel mounting bolts. Use wheel impact socket #17.
Step 9
Raise the rear of the car and secure on supports.
Step 10
Unscrew the wheel bolts.
AUTODOC recommends:
Warning! To avoid injury, hold the wheel while unscrewing the fastening bolts. VW SHARAN (7N1, 7N2)
Step 11
Remove the wheel.
Step 12
Spread the brake pads. Use a crowbar.
Step 13
Clean the brake caliper fasteners. Use a wire brush. Use WD-40 spray.
Step 14
Unscrew the brake caliper fastening. Use a combination spanner #13. Use a combination spanner #15. Use a drive socket #13. Use a ratchet wrench.
Step 15
Remove the brake caliper.
Replacement: brake pads – VW SHARAN (7N1, 7N2). Tip from AUTODOC experts:
Tie the caliper to the suspension or to the body with a wire without disconnecting from the brake hose to prevent depressurization of the brake system.Make sure that the brake caliper is not hanging on the brake hose.Don't press the brake pedal after the brake caliper has been removed. As a result, the piston can fall out from the brake cylinder, and brake fluid leakage and depressurization of the system may occur. Check the brake caliper bracket, brake caliper guide pins and boots. Clean them. Replace, if necessary.
